Why should professional services firms standardize project finance and approval workflows in ERP?
They should standardize these workflows to protect margin, shorten cycle times, and reduce control gaps across project delivery, finance, and leadership teams. In many professional services organizations, project setup, budget approvals, change requests, timesheet validation, expense review, billing readiness, and revenue-related decisions are handled differently by practice, region, or manager. That inconsistency creates delayed invoicing, disputed costs, weak audit trails, and unreliable forecasting. A well-designed ERP workflow strategy replaces ad hoc approvals with governed, role-based orchestration so the business can scale delivery without scaling confusion.
The business case is straightforward: standardization improves decision quality and operational predictability. Executives gain clearer visibility into who approved what, under which policy, and at what point in the project lifecycle. Delivery leaders gain faster handoffs between sales, project management, resource management, and finance. Finance teams gain stronger control over billing, margin leakage, and exception handling. For partners, MSPs, consultants, and integrators, this is not only a systems project; it is an operating model decision that determines how consistently the firm converts delivery effort into recognized revenue.
What processes should be standardized first?
Start with the workflows that directly affect cash flow, margin, and compliance. In most firms, the highest-value candidates are project creation, budget approval, rate card exceptions, resource request approvals, timesheet and expense approvals, change order authorization, billing readiness checks, invoice release, and project closure. These processes usually cross multiple functions, involve repeated manual decisions, and create measurable delays when they are not standardized.
- Prioritize workflows with high transaction volume, high financial impact, and frequent exceptions.
- Sequence automation so foundational controls such as project setup and approval matrices are established before advanced AI-assisted automation.
How do leaders decide which workflow model fits the business?
The right model depends on service complexity, organizational structure, and control requirements. Firms with standardized offerings and centralized finance can often use a common approval matrix with limited local variation. Firms with multiple practices, geographies, or contract models may need a federated design where core policies are standardized but thresholds, approvers, and exception paths vary by business unit. The decision framework should evaluate process criticality, approval frequency, policy variance, integration dependencies, and the cost of delay. If a workflow affects billing or revenue recognition, governance should be stricter than for low-risk internal requests.
A practical decision framework asks five questions: Is the process financially material? Does it require segregation of duties? Does it span multiple systems? Are exceptions common enough to justify dynamic routing? Can the business define a single policy owner? If the answer is yes to most of these, the workflow belongs in a governed ERP orchestration layer rather than in email, spreadsheets, or manager discretion.
What architecture supports reliable ERP workflow standardization?
The most reliable architecture separates system of record, workflow orchestration, integration, and monitoring responsibilities. The ERP remains the authoritative source for project, financial, and approval state. A workflow orchestration layer manages routing, business rules, escalations, and exception handling. Integration services connect CRM, PSA, HR, procurement, expense, and document systems through REST APIs, webhooks, middleware, or iPaaS patterns. Monitoring and observability track failures, latency, retries, and policy breaches. This separation reduces customization risk inside the ERP while preserving end-to-end control.
Event-driven architecture is especially useful when approvals trigger downstream actions such as project activation, purchase authorization, billing release, or notifications to collaboration tools. Instead of relying on batch updates, event-based workflows can react to status changes in near real time. That improves responsiveness and reduces reconciliation work. However, event-driven design requires disciplined schema management, idempotency controls, and clear ownership of business events to avoid duplicate actions or inconsistent states.
| Architecture Decision | Best Fit | Primary Benefit | Trade-off |
|---|---|---|---|
| ERP-native workflow | Simple approval chains with limited integrations | Lower complexity and faster initial deployment | Can become rigid for cross-system orchestration |
| External workflow orchestration | Multi-step approvals across ERP and adjacent systems | Greater flexibility, governance, and reuse | Requires stronger integration and operational discipline |
| Event-driven workflow model | High-volume, time-sensitive process automation | Faster response and better scalability | Needs mature monitoring and error handling |
| Hybrid model | Organizations balancing ERP controls with enterprise automation | Practical path for phased modernization | Governance must prevent duplicated logic |
How should firms design approval rules without slowing the business?
They should design approvals around risk, not hierarchy alone. Many firms over-engineer approval chains by routing every decision upward, which increases delay without improving control. A better model uses role-based thresholds, policy-driven routing, and exception-based escalation. For example, standard project budgets within approved rate cards may require only delivery and finance validation, while nonstandard pricing, margin exceptions, or contract changes trigger additional review. This keeps routine work moving while preserving executive attention for material decisions.
Approval design should also account for delegation, service-level targets, and fallback logic. If an approver is unavailable, the workflow should escalate based on predefined rules rather than stall. If required data is missing, the workflow should return the request with structured remediation guidance. If a policy exception is approved, the system should capture rationale and maintain an audit trail. These details matter because the operational quality of the workflow often determines adoption more than the automation technology itself.
Where does AI-assisted automation add value in project finance workflows?
AI-assisted automation adds the most value in summarization, anomaly detection, exception triage, and decision support, not in replacing financial accountability. For example, AI can summarize a change request, compare it to project budget history, flag unusual margin impact, or recommend the likely approval path based on policy and prior decisions. It can also help classify incoming requests, extract data from supporting documents, and surface missing information before a human review begins.
The governance boundary is important. Final approval authority for financially material actions should remain with accountable roles defined by policy. AI outputs should be explainable, logged, and reviewable. If retrieval-based guidance is used through RAG, the source policies, contract terms, and approval rules must be current and controlled. In enterprise settings, AI should accelerate decision preparation and exception handling rather than become an opaque approval engine.
What implementation roadmap reduces disruption and accelerates ROI?
A phased roadmap reduces risk by aligning process redesign, data readiness, and technical rollout. Phase one should document current-state workflows, approval actors, policy exceptions, and integration points. Process mining can help identify bottlenecks, rework loops, and hidden variants. Phase two should define the target operating model, approval matrix, data ownership, and architecture pattern. Phase three should implement a limited set of high-value workflows, usually project setup, budget approval, and billing readiness. Phase four should expand to change orders, expenses, resource approvals, and advanced exception handling. Phase five should focus on optimization, observability, and continuous governance.
This sequence matters because many ERP workflow programs fail when firms automate broken processes or ignore master data quality. Standardization should not mean forcing every team into an unrealistic template. It means defining a controlled baseline, documenting approved variants, and making exceptions visible. How should firms approach migration from manual or fragmented approvals?
They should migrate by policy domain and business impact, not by attempting a full cutover of every approval at once. Begin by inventorying current approval paths across email, spreadsheets, collaboration tools, and legacy systems. Map each path to a target workflow, identify required data fields, and define which historical records must be retained for audit or reporting. During transition, dual-run periods may be necessary for financially sensitive processes so teams can validate routing, timing, and downstream posting behavior before retiring legacy methods.
Migration planning should also address user adoption, role mapping, and exception ownership. If approvers do not trust the new workflow, they will bypass it. If role assignments are incomplete, requests will queue without action. If exception handling is undefined, teams will revert to side-channel approvals. A successful migration therefore combines technical deployment with policy communication, training, and operational support.
What governance and compliance controls are essential?
Essential controls include segregation of duties, role-based access, approval threshold policies, immutable audit trails, retention rules, and monitored exception handling. Governance should define who owns each workflow, who can change business rules, how emergency changes are approved, and how policy updates are tested before release. In regulated or audit-sensitive environments, workflow evidence must be easy to retrieve and tied to the underlying transaction record.
Operational governance is equally important. Firms need release management for workflow changes, version control for rules, and observability for failed integrations or stuck approvals. Monitoring should track approval cycle time, exception volume, rework rate, overdue tasks, and policy override frequency. These metrics help leaders distinguish between healthy process variation and control breakdown.
| Control Area | Why It Matters | Recommended Practice |
|---|---|---|
| Segregation of duties | Prevents conflicted approvals and control failures | Separate request, review, and financial release roles |
| Audit trail | Supports compliance, dispute resolution, and accountability | Log decisions, timestamps, rationale, and source data |
| Rule governance | Prevents uncontrolled workflow drift | Use change approval, testing, and versioning for business rules |
| Monitoring | Detects delays and integration failures early | Track SLAs, exceptions, retries, and workflow health |
What common mistakes undermine ERP workflow standardization?
The most common mistakes are automating inconsistent policies, embedding too much custom logic inside the ERP, ignoring exception paths, and treating approvals as a technical routing problem instead of a business control system. Another frequent error is designing workflows around current org charts rather than durable business roles. When managers change, the workflow breaks. When roles are defined by policy, the workflow remains stable.
- Do not standardize forms and screens while leaving approval criteria ambiguous or undocumented.
- Do not launch automation without monitoring, escalation rules, and ownership for failed or stalled transactions.
Firms also underestimate data dependencies. If project codes, customer records, rate cards, or cost centers are inconsistent, workflow automation will expose those issues quickly. That is not a reason to delay forever, but it is a reason to include data remediation and governance in the program scope.
What business outcomes should executives expect and how should they measure success?
Executives should expect faster approvals, fewer billing delays, stronger margin control, better audit readiness, and more consistent project governance. The exact impact depends on process maturity and adoption, but the measurable outcomes are usually clear. Track approval cycle time, percentage of straight-through approvals, billing readiness lead time, exception rate, rework volume, invoice release speed, and the number of policy overrides. Also measure qualitative outcomes such as improved cross-functional accountability and reduced dependence on tribal knowledge.
ROI should be evaluated across both efficiency and control dimensions. Efficiency gains come from reduced manual coordination, fewer follow-ups, and faster transaction completion. Control gains come from fewer unauthorized exceptions, better documentation, and more reliable financial operations. In executive terms, the value is not just lower administrative effort; it is a more scalable operating model for project-based growth.
How will these workflow strategies evolve over the next few years?
The direction is toward more composable workflow architecture, stronger event-driven integration, and broader use of AI-assisted decision support. Professional services firms will increasingly expect approval workflows to span ERP, CRM, collaboration, document, and analytics platforms without heavy custom development. Process mining and observability will become standard tools for continuous optimization rather than one-time transformation aids.
At the same time, governance expectations will rise. As AI agents and automation platforms become more capable, firms will need clearer policy boundaries, stronger approval evidence, and better controls over who can change workflow logic. The organizations that benefit most will be those that treat workflow standardization as an enterprise capability, not a one-off ERP configuration task.
